Default 01 s80 engine light

My problem started when I had to jump the car one day after work, it was hard to jump the car for some reason to begin with but after a few attempts we got it running. As I was driving the check engine light came on and was blinking but the car appeared to be running smoothly so I figured it would go away at one point.

Nope, till this day the cars check engine light is still on, and it blinks when I go past 40 mph, I got it checked at auto zone and the code came back as p0030 which didnt really tell me what was really wrong with it, more like what could be wrong with it.

The new problem that i'm noticing is that I'm getting lower gas mileage and the rpms seems to be running a bit high, they fluctuate actually.

My final problem is that my break light wont work at all even after replacing the bulb the mid break light on the back car window works fine but the break light don't.

Any ideas ?

P0030 ECM-2810 Front heated oxygen sensor (HO2S), preheating

Signal missing. Permanent fault
